Output e751117c30736a6e17b3a4895228c11a3cbb45e1b6c0180d61edb27fecedef69:0

value
509700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652b49e524d363e4c05880d527e6287b3603cd4f OP_EQUAL
address
3Aux2fdrmMSijzfUvsS2h263Qr74oomXQJ
transaction
e751117c30736a6e17b3a4895228c11a3cbb45e1b6c0180d61edb27fecedef69
spent
true